Eyes not getting enough oxygen

I wear gas permeable contact lenses. Always have.
Since they are literally smaller than soft contacts and they are gas permeable air naturally goes in and out. They are 'dry' since they don't need moisture. Your tears are plenty. I also don't need (nor want) to take them out for naps, sleep etc. I barely take them out at all. I buy one bottle of solution a year. I have been TRYING to be better about giving my eyes a rest and even got glasses but frankly I love having full vision. Since my Rx is so very very bad -7.50 and -8.00 I prefer to keep my lenses in. Doc used to lecture me about taking them out but I'm 40 and been wearing these types of contacts since 18. Never had build up. LOL I never feel them unless I get an eyelash oh then the AGONY!
